 For this month let me share this scripture with you from 1John 4:4
 
 "Ye are of God, little children, and have overcome them: because greater is he that is in you, than he that is in the world".
   This scripture is not just for your children, but is also applicable for you as well if you are a Christian. Greater is He that is in you and in your children than he that is in the world. So many times we just look at our situation and accept defeat. We see our problems as so much bigger than the divine presence of the Holy Spirit that we have abiding within us. I once heard someone say- "don't tell God how big your problem is, instead tell your problem how big your God is" Such a true statement.
 
 Remind yourself and your children that victory belongs to you. God has already overcome- so will you. Neither you nor your children will get burn when thrown in the fire. Neither you nor your children will be drowned when tossed in the river. The key is not to be self-reliant. It is not by your strength or your might instead it is by His Spirit- tap into it
